Kwara Gov Moves To Grant Judiciary, Legislature Autonomy

Date: 2022-03-23

Kwara State governor, AbdulRahaman AbdulRazaq, on Tuesday, sent two Executive Bills to the State House of Assembly, seeking to grant financial autonomy to both legislative and judicial arms of the state government.

The Bills are Kwara State Legislative Fund Management Bill 2022 and Kwara State Judiciary Fund Management Bill 2022.

The Speaker of the House, Engr. Yakubu Danladi-Salihu, read the two separate messages from the governor on the Executive Bills during Tuesday’s plenary.

The Bills seek to confer autonomy on the state legislature and judiciary for the management and control of recurrent and capital expenditures in line with the provision of the Nigerian Constitution as amended

Governor AbdulRazaq urged the House to give the Bills the usual quick consideration and passage.

Speaker Danladi-Salihu later referred the two Bills to the Business and Rules Committee of the House, asking the committee to slate the Bills for first reading at the appropriate time.
